Dupliquer un ordonnancement - Cloud

Guide d'utilisation des API Talend Cloud

Version
Cloud
Language
Français
Product
Talend Cloud
Module
Talend API Designer
Talend API Tester
Talend Data Preparation
Talend Data Stewardship
Talend Management Console
Content
Création et développement > Création d'APIs
Création et développement > Test d'API
Comme un ordonnancement peut être associé à une seule tâche ou à un seul plan, dupliquez cet ordonnancement pour le réutiliser avec d'autres tâches ou plans.

Avant de commencer

  • Générez des jetons d'accès :

    Une fois généré, un jeton de compte de service expire après 30 minutes. S'il expire, générez un nouveau jeton à l'aide de la méthode POST sur l'endpoint https://api.<env>.cloud.talend.com/security/oauth/token. Pour plus d'informations concernant la génération d'un jeton, consultez Générer un jeton de compte de service.

  • Vous devez connaître l'ID de l'ordonnancement pour lequel vous souhaitez simuler des événements.
  • Assurez-vous que l'utilisateur·trice ou le compte de service à utiliser a l'autorisation View sur au moins un espace de travail de l'environnement.

Procédure

Clonez l'ordonnancement à l'aide de la requête d'API suivante :

Exemple

Tous les déclencheurs sont dupliqués dans le nouvel ordonnancement. Le nouvel ordonnancement est nommé d'après cette convention de nommage : copie du nom de l'ordonnancement original.

method: POST
endpoint: https://api.<env>.cloud.talend.com/orchestration/schedules/<scheduleId>
headers: {
      "Content-Type": "application/json",
      "Authorization": "Bearer <your_personal_access_token_or_service_account_token>"
          }
payload: N/A

Résultats

Vous pouvez à présent effectuer les opérations suivantes en toute sécurité :
  1. gestion des modifications : cloner l'ordonnancement attribué à votre tâche ou plan, mettre à jour la copie, simuler des événements et lorsque l'ordonnancement est prêt, désaffecter l'ordonnancement original, attribuer cette copie à votre tâche ou plan
  2. conserver les versions de l'ordonnancement à des fins de rollback ou d'historique
  3. réutiliser et adapter les ordonnancements existants à d'autres tâches ou plans